Stephen J. Kennel is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and Immunology and Allergy. According to data from OpenAlex, Stephen J. Kennel has authored 202 papers receiving a total of 6.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 120 papers in Molecular Biology, 96 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and 31 papers in Immunology and Allergy. Recurrent topics in Stephen J. Kennel’s work include Monoclonal and Polyclonal Antibodies Research (62 papers), Amyloidosis: Diagnosis, Treatment, Outcomes (52 papers) and Radiopharmaceutical Chemistry and Applications (43 papers). Stephen J. Kennel is often cited by papers focused on Monoclonal and Polyclonal Antibodies Research (62 papers), Amyloidosis: Diagnosis, Treatment, Outcomes (52 papers) and Radiopharmaceutical Chemistry and Applications (43 papers). Stephen J. Kennel collaborates with scholars based in United States, Italy and Japan. Stephen J. Kennel's co-authors include Leaf Huang, Saed Mirzadeh, Jonathan S. Wall, Linda J. Foote, Rita Falcioni, Arnoud Sonnenberg, Trish K. Lankford, Kazuo Maruyama, Alice H. Huang and Alan Stuckey and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Journal of the American Chemical Society and Journal of Biological Chemistry.
